We've had a real problem with a some of our customers who have dedicated
dial-up accounts with their own lines at our POPs. They've had their
connections drop anywhere from 2 to 10 times per day. Anytime I try it, I
stay connected forever, but being as most of these are remote sites, the only
test I can afford to run like that is a login session from one PM port to
another. So, now this particular customer changes from Windows 95 to BSDI
and...well...read for yourself.

I though you might want to know something about our dialup connection that
I find somewhat interesting.... we have not had a *single* line drop with
our Freeway dedicated modem attached to our new BSDI Unix machine. Not a
single one. I've left the line attached for entire 24-hr periods with no
drops (I always had 2-4 drops a day under Win95).

So, either it's a coincidence and I'm just on a lucky run, or there really
might be some kind of fundamental incompatibility when running Win95
attached via dialup to the portmaster.
